Il s'agit d'une pièce en laque Tuo Tai fabriquée à partir de laque brute, d'argile et de tissu, avec des accents de cuivre ornant son bord , y compris deux clous décoratifs, ajoutant une touche de style wabisabi à cet article.

Voici une œuvre de Kevin. Vous lirez les signes « 太戊 » (Pingyin en Tai Wu) et « 袁 » (Pingyin en Yuan) au milieu en bas.

L'ensemble du plat est recouvert d'une laque couleur laiton, associée à des textures uniques, lui conférant une allure élégante et ludique. Généralement utilisé comme plateau à thé ou assiette à dessert, nous serions ravis de vous faire découvrir d'autres utilisations créatives.

Diamètre : 12,5 cm"

What is Chinese lacquer (Da Qi)?

Chinese lacquer, known as Da Qi, is a natural resin extracted from the lacquer tree. It forms a durable surface with a soft, glowing finish and is used for repairing ceramics or creating handcrafted trays, jewelry, and decorative pieces.
